What is Bonito?
Bonito is a type of fish that is popular in many cuisines around the world. It is known for its firm flesh and rich flavor, making it a perfect choice for a wide range of dishes.
Grilled Bonito Recipe
- Ingredients:
- – Fresh bonito fillets
- – Olive oil
- – Salt and pepper to taste
1. Preheat your grill to medium-high heat.
2. Brush the bonito fillets with olive oil and season them with salt and pepper.
3. Place the fillets on the hot grill and cook for about 4-5 minutes on each side, or until they are cooked through.
4. Serve the grilled bonito with a squeeze of lemon and enjoy!
Bonito and Vegetable Stir-Fry Recipe
- Ingredients:
- – Fresh bonito fillets
- – Assorted vegetables (bell peppers, carrots, broccoli, etc.)
- – Soy sauce
- – Garlic powder
- – Sesame oil
1. Cut the bonito fillets into bite-sized pieces.
2. Heat some sesame oil in a pan over medium heat.
3. Add the assorted vegetables to the pan and stir-fry them until they are tender-crisp.
4. Push the vegetables to one side of the pan and add the bonito pieces to the other side.
5. Sprinkle some garlic powder over the bonito and cook for about 2-3 minutes on each side, or until the fish is cooked through.
6. Add soy sauce to the pan and mix everything together.
7. Serve the bonito and vegetable stir-fry over steamed rice and enjoy!
Bonito Salad Recipe
- Ingredients:
- – Fresh bonito fillets
- – Mixed salad greens
- – Cherry tomatoes
- – Cucumber
- – Red onion
- – Lemon juice
- – Olive oil
- – Salt and pepper to taste
1. Season the bonito fillets with salt and pepper.
2. Heat some olive oil in a pan over medium-high heat.
3. Add the bonito fillets to the pan and cook for about 2-3 minutes on each side, or until they are cooked through.
4. Remove the bonito from the pan and let it cool for a few minutes.
5. In the meantime, prepare a bed of mixed salad greens on a serving plate.
6. Slice the cherry tomatoes, cucumber, and red onion, and arrange them on top of the greens.
7. Flake the cooked bonito into bite-sized pieces and place them on the salad.
8. Drizzle some lemon juice and olive oil over the salad.
9. Season with salt and pepper to taste.
10. Toss everything together and serve the bonito salad chilled.
